Join Citi as a Java/J2EE Developer in Pune and become part of a global technology team that powers innovative banking solutions for millions of customers worldwide.
This exciting Officer/C10 level position offers an excellent opportunity to work with cutting-edge technologies while contributing to applications that make a real impact in the financial services industry.
Ready to advance your career with one of the world’s leading financial institutions? Check out the details below and apply today!
Job Information
Job ID | 25840076 |
Posting Date | 07/06/2025 |
Company | Citi Bank |
Company Website | https://citi.com |
Role | Developer Java/J2EE – Officer/C10 |
Experience | 2 to 5+ years |
Job Type | On Site |
Location | Pune, Maharashtra |
Estimated Salary | โน15,00,000 ~ โน22,00,000 |
Job Description
- The Applications Development Programmer Analyst role at Citi is an intermediate-level position that plays a crucial part in establishing and implementing innovative application systems and programs.
- You will work collaboratively with the Technology team to contribute to applications systems analysis and programming activities that support Citi’s global operations.
- This position offers the opportunity to work on complex technical challenges while developing expertise in business processes, system procedures, and industry standards.
- The role involves hands-on programming, debugging, and system enhancement activities that directly impact the bank’s technological infrastructure.
- You’ll be responsible for conducting thorough testing, implementing solutions, and ensuring compliance with Citi’s high standards for risk management and regulatory requirements.
Responsibilities
- You will utilize your knowledge of applications development procedures and concepts to identify, define, and implement necessary system enhancements that improve operational efficiency.
- You will analyze complex technical issues, make strategic recommendations, and implement robust solutions that align with business objectives and industry best practices.
- You will conduct comprehensive testing and debugging activities, utilize advanced script tools, and write high-quality code that meets strict design specifications and performance standards.
- You will develop and maintain working knowledge of Citi’s information systems, procedures, standards, and various technical domains including database administration and network operations.
- You will collaborate with cross-functional teams to assess applicability of similar experiences and evaluate multiple solution options for complex scenarios not covered by standard procedures.
- You will appropriately assess risk in business decisions while demonstrating particular consideration for the firm’s reputation and ensuring compliance with applicable laws and regulations.
Key Skills
- Core Java Programming: Strong understanding of collections, multithreading, and object-oriented principles
- Spring Framework: Experience with Spring Boot, Spring MVC, and dependency injection patterns
- Database Management: Working knowledge of RDBMS, SQL optimization, and data modeling
- Design Patterns: Understanding of common design patterns and software architecture principles
- Frontend Technologies: Experience with ExtJS, Angular, or similar JavaScript frameworks
- Problem Solving: Strong analytical and logical thinking abilities for complex technical challenges
- Communication Skills: Excellent written and verbal communication for cross-functional collaboration
- SDLC Knowledge: Familiarity with Agile methodologies and standard software development lifecycle
Qualifications
- Experience: 2-5 years of relevant experience in Java/J2EE development and business application programming
- Education: Bachelor’s degree in Computer Science, Engineering, or equivalent technical experience
- Technical Skills: Demonstrated proficiency in programming languages, debugging, and working knowledge of industry standards
- Business Knowledge: Comprehensive understanding of specific business areas for application development
- Communication: Consistently clear and concise written and verbal communication skills
- Problem Solving: Strong logical abilities with proven track record of solving complex technical issues
About Citi
- Citi is a leading global financial services company with operations in more than 160 countries and jurisdictions, serving millions of consumers, corporations, governments, and institutions worldwide.
- With over 230,000 dedicated employees globally, Citi is committed to delivering innovative financial solutions and maintaining the highest standards of integrity and excellence.
Benefits
- Comprehensive Health Insurance: Medical coverage for employees and family members with extensive network of healthcare providers
- Professional Development: Sponsored training courses, technology certifications, and management education with tuition reimbursement opportunities
- Work-Life Balance: Flexible working arrangements, wellness programs, and access to on-site facilities including gym and doctor services
- Career Growth: Structured career development programs, mentorship opportunities, and clear advancement pathways within the global organization
- Transportation & Convenience: Two-way transportation facilities and childcare support to ensure work-life integration.
How to Apply?
Disclaimer: By clicking “Apply Now,” you acknowledge that you are being redirected to the employer’s application page. vacancies.dev is a job board and does not manage the hiring process or the handling of your personal information. Please review the employer’s job posting, privacy policy and application instructions before proceeding.